Latest Patents

Yamoto's latest patents include a locking apparatus and loadboard assembly for semiconductor testing devices. This invention focuses on a loadboard assembly that integrates a printed circuit board containing a device under test and an interface board. The interface board is designed with two members that create apertures for contact pins on a test head, allowing for precise placement and locking of the loadboard assembly. His second patent, the test head Hifix, enhances the maintenance and repair process of semiconductor testing apparatuses by allowing easy access without complete disassembly. This innovative design includes a plate that can be moved without detaching it from the test head, streamlining the maintenance process.
